Description

Lymburgh's Farmhouse is a farmhouse that likely dates back to the 17th century but was mostly remodeled in the early 19th century. It is constructed from coursed, squared rubble and features a gable-ended, tiled roof with brick stacks at both ends. The building has two storeys and a three-window range, with three-light cast-iron casements that include glazing bars. The entrance has a flush panelled, part-glazed door. While there are no visible internal features of interest, it is possible that they are hidden behind later renovations.
